FOR THE Wedding, Anniversary or Engagement Announcement More people enter workforce in June MILWAUKEE — Wisconsin unemploy- ment rose slightly to 2.9 percent in June from a record low 2.8 percent in April and May, the state said. The percentage bumped up because of 3,300 individuals entering the labor force, the Wisconsin Department of Workforce Development said. For the first time in state history, Wisconsin's unemployment rate has been under 3.0 percent for five consecutive months, the DWD said. Even with the percentage increase in June, the state hit a record number with 3,092,100 people employed for the month. "These are historically good times for Wisconsin's economy," Gov. Scott Walker said. Wisconsin gained 7,400 nonfarm and 5,500 private-sector jobs from May to June, and the state gained 17,600 manufacturing jobs from last June, the federal Bureau of Labor Statistics figures showed. Woman, 85, dies after crash MILWAUKEE — Edna Nuell, 85, of Milwaukee, died after a crash involving at least four vehicles at 8:40 p.m. Sunday northbound on Interstate 41-94 at Edgerton Avenue, according to the Sheriff's Office. Three vehicles slowed for traffic conges- tion, but another vehicle failed to react in time, striking one vehicle which then struck two others, witnesses told deputies. One driver was cited for imprudent speed and inattentive driving, the Sheriff's Office reported.
